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
027624613 57041 2335 12 421262
20987889 356956 876987554
20987889 356956 876987554
5137664 7465216 062669
All about undefined
Interested in learning more?
20987889 356956 876987554
5137664 7465216 062669
See more
247 43 25044240
62648685784 73 39 61393
See more
239 96
59178 9769 1608702
See more